首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ql:自动将某些列的秒转换为小时

MySQL是一种开源的关系型数据库管理系统,它是目前最流行的数据库之一。MySQL具有以下特点和优势:

概念: MySQL是一种关系型数据库管理系统,它使用结构化查询语言(SQL)进行数据管理。它采用客户端/服务器模型,通过在服务器上存储数据并提供对数据的访问来实现数据管理。

分类: MySQL属于关系型数据库管理系统(RDBMS),它使用表格来存储和组织数据。每个表格由行和列组成,行表示记录,列表示字段。

优势:

  1. 可靠性:MySQL具有高度的稳定性和可靠性,能够处理大规模的数据和高并发访问。
  2. 可扩展性:MySQL支持水平和垂直扩展,可以根据需求增加服务器和存储容量。
  3. 性能优化:MySQL提供了多种性能优化工具和技术,如索引、查询优化、缓存等,以提高数据库的响应速度和吞吐量。
  4. 安全性:MySQL提供了丰富的安全功能,包括用户认证、访问控制、数据加密等,以保护数据的安全性和完整性。
  5. 灵活性:MySQL支持多种数据类型和数据处理功能,可以满足不同应用场景的需求。

应用场景: MySQL广泛应用于各种Web应用程序、企业级应用、移动应用等场景,包括电子商务网站、社交媒体平台、金融系统、物流管理系统等。

推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了多种与MySQL相关的产品和服务,包括云数据库MySQL、数据库备份、数据库审计等。您可以通过以下链接了解更多信息:

  1. 腾讯云数据库MySQL:https://cloud.tencent.com/product/cdb 腾讯云数据库MySQL是一种高性能、可扩展的云数据库服务,提供了稳定可靠的MySQL数据库环境,支持自动备份、容灾、监控等功能。
  2. 腾讯云数据库备份:https://cloud.tencent.com/product/cbs 腾讯云数据库备份服务可以帮助您定期备份MySQL数据库,保证数据的安全性和可恢复性。
  3. 腾讯云数据库审计:https://cloud.tencent.com/product/das 腾讯云数据库审计服务可以记录和分析MySQL数据库的操作日志,帮助您监控数据库的安全性和合规性。

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

数据库之数据类型详解

优化建议: MySQL能存储小时间粒度为。 建议用DATE数据类型来保存日期。...2)TIME TIME 类型格式为 HH:MM:SS ,HH 表示小时,MM 表示分钟,SS 表示 格式1:以 'HHMMSS' 格式表示 TIME ,例如 '101112' 被理解为 10:11...4)DATETIME DATETIME 类型格式为 YYYY-MM-DD HH:MM:SS ,其中,YYYY 表示年,MM 表示月,DD 表示日,HH 表示小时,MM 表示分钟,SS 表示; 格式1...3、ENUM 在基本数据类型中,无外乎就是些数字和字符,但是某些事物是较难用数字和字符来准确地表示。...; 如果插入 SET 字段中值有重复,则 MySQL 自动删除重复值,插入 SET 字段顺序并不重要,MySQL 会在存入数据库时,按照定义顺序显示。

1.5K30

一场pandas与SQL巅峰大战(三)

下面我们提取一下ts字段中天,时间,年,月,日,时,分,信息。 ? 在MySQL和Hive中,由于ts字段是字符串格式存储,我们只需使用字符串截取函数即可。...可以验证最后一十位数字就是ts时间戳形式。 ps.在此之前,我尝试了另外一种借助numpy方式,进行类型转换,但转出来结果不正确,比期望结果多8个小时,我写在这里,欢迎有经验读者指正。...在pandas中,我们看一下如何str_timestamp换为原来ts。这里依然采用time模块中方法来实现。 ?...位 对于初始是ts这样年月日时分秒形式,我们通常需要先转换为10位年月日格式,再把中间横杠替换掉,就可以得到8位日期了。...由于打算使用字符串替换,我们先要将ts转换为字符串形式,在前面的转换中,我们生成了一str_ts,该数据类型是object,相当于字符串,可以在此基础上进行这里转换。 ?

4.5K20

MySQL 8.0中DATE,DATETIME和 TIMESTAMP类型和5.7之间差异

如果 explicit_defaults_for_timestamp 禁用,则服务器TIMESTAMP 按以下方式处理: 除非另有说明,如果未显式分配值,则表中第一 TIMESTAMP被定义为自动设置为最新修改日期和时间...也可以TIMESTAMP通过为其分配NULL值来任何设置为当前日期和时间 ,除非已使用NULL,允许NULL值属性对其进行 了定义。...默认情况下,第一TIMESTAMP 具有这些属性,如前所述。但是,TIMESTAMP可以表中任何定义为具有这些属性。 小数部分应始终与其余时间间隔一个小数点;无法识别其他小数秒分隔符。...后续文章会进行讲解; MySQLTIMESTAMP值从当前时区转换为UTC以进行存储,然后从UTC转换为当前时区以进行检索。(对于其他类型,例如DATETIME。不会发生这种情况。)...中日期值解释某些属性: * MySQL允许对指定为字符串值使用“放松”格式,其中任何标点字符都可以用作日期部分或时间部分之间分隔符。

6K51

Mysql占用过高CPU时优化手段

time,此这个状态持续时间,单位是。...通常来说,把wait_timeout设置为10小时是个不错选择,但某些情况下可能也会出问题,比如说有一个CRON脚本,其中两次SQL查询间隔时间大于10的话,那么这个设置就有问题了(当然,这也不是不能解决问题...,你可以在程序里时不时mysql_ping一下,以便服务器知道你还活着,重新计算wait_timeout时间): MySQL服务器默认“wait_timeout”是28800即8小时,意味着如果一个连接空闲时间超过...8个小时MySQL自动断开该连接。...可以mysql全局变量wait_timeout缺省值改大。 查看mysql手册,发现对wait_timeout最大值分别是24天/365天(windows/linux)。

4.6K120

MySQL 日期字符串转换

文章目录 日期查询 1)查询当前时间日期 2)时间戳 3)时间截取(返回对应日期,时间或者数字) 日期操作 日期时间增减 日期字符串转化 日期字符串 字符串日期 以下函数执行在mysql5.7版本下...,高版本mysql可能某些函数存在差异 日期查询 1)查询当前时间日期 now() 获取 当前日期和时间 //2018-04-12 18:18:57 curdate() 当前日期,///2018-04...%h 小时,12进制[0-11] %i 分钟 [0-59] %s | %S 0-59 3)时间截取(返回对应日期,时间或者数字) 日期操作 日期时间增减 ADDDATE(date,INTERVAL...expr unit) date 要操作日期时间,可以是日期类型也可以是日期字符串 INTERVAL: MySQL关键字 ,意思是间隔,间隙 unit 操作单元,年,月,日,时,分,对应==YEAR...[0-59] %s | %S 0-59 日期字符串 DATE_FORMAT(date,pattern) //日期转化为指定模式字符串 TIME_FORMAT(time,pattern) //

3.6K20

全功能数据库管理工具-RazorSQL 10大版本发布

:在弹出窗口中添加了数据类型和大小 Windows:改进了使用缩放超过 100% Windows 系统上用户界面缩放 Linux:RazorSQL 将在某些 Linux 系统上自动缩放显示 二进制数据编辑器...(只包含密码文件)支持 数据库转换:在转换为 MySQL / MariaDB 时,添加了选择生成 SQL 插入类型(INSERT、REPLACE 或 INSERT IGNORE)能力 向 DB...DDL 时不再为默认主键索引生成创建索引语句 Firebird 到 PostgreSQL 表转换:Double 和 Float 现在转换为 PostgreSQL 双精度 Salesforce:评论会自动从查询中删除...SQL 选项中用单引号而不是 # 括起来 某些窗口在深色模式下未显示正确文本颜色 RazorSQL 不再在某些 Windows 7 机器上启动 MySQL:创建函数工具 IN 关键字放在参数前面...自动完成焦点返回到查找对话框而不是编辑器 命令行调用生成器:在某些情况下不出现多行语法部分 Windows:当缩放比例超过 100% 时,使用某些字体大小时,单击鼠标可能会将光标位置放在鼠标指针位置左侧或右侧

3.8K20

官方可行性报告为你解答

UTC 5 月 5 日 00:45(持续 2 小时 24 分钟) 在事件发生期间,共享数据库表自动增量 ID 超过了 MySQL Integer 类型(Railsint(11)):2147483647...UTC 5 月 22 日 16:41(持续 5 小时 09 分钟) 在原定维护操作(MySQL 主实例失败)期间,在新升级 MySQL 主服务器上 MySQL 进程经历了一次新崩溃。...为了减轻崩溃带来影响,我们手动流量重定向到原始主服务器。但是,崩溃 MySQL 主服务器已经提供了大约 6 写流量。...一周后,我们一个主数据库集群上 MySQL 主节点出现故障,并被一个新主机自动替换。几秒钟内,新升级主服务器崩溃。Orchestrator[2] 防止互相踢皮球机制阻止了随后自动故障转移。...我们正在分析应用程序日志、MySQL 核心储和我们内部遥测,作为继续调查 CPU 耗尽问题一部分,以避免类似的故障模式继续。 总结 作为一个组织,我们继续在可行性方面投入大量资金。

71920

第四章《MySQL数据类型和运算符》

系统“零”值插入到数据库中 ?...类型格式为 HH:MM:SS ,HH 表示小时,MM 表示分钟,SS 表示 (2) 格式:以 ‘HHMMSS’ 格式表示 TIME ,例如 ‘101112’ 被理解为 10:11:12 ,但如果插入不合法时间...DATETIME 类型格式为 YYYY-MM-DD HH:MM:SS ,其中,YYYY 表示年,MM 表示月,DD 表示日,HH 表示小时,MM 表示分钟,SS 表示 (2) 格式:‘YYYY-MM-DD...个值 (3)ENUM和SET值是以字符串形式出现,但在内部MySQL以数值形式进行存储; ENUM: (1)在基本数据类型中,无外乎就是写数字和字符串,但是某些事物是较难用数字和字符来准确表示...(4)如果插入SET字段中值有重复,则MySQL自动删除重复值,插入SET字段顺序并不重要,MySQL会在存入数据库时,按照定义顺序显示 ?

96110

第四章《MySQL数据类型和运算符》

:SS ,HH 表示小时,MM 表示分钟,SS 表示 (2) 格式:以 ‘HHMMSS’ 格式表示 TIME ,例如 ‘101112’ 被理解为 10:11:12 ,但如果插入不合法时间,如 ‘...DATETIME 类型格式为 YYYY-MM-DD HH:MM:SS ,其中,YYYY 表示年,MM 表示月,DD 表示日,HH 表示小时,MM 表示分钟,SS 表示 (2) 格式:‘YYYY-MM-DD...DATETIME; (3)默认情况下,当插入一条记录但并没有指定TIMESTAMP这个值时,MySQL默认会把TIMESTAMP设为当前时间 3.字符串; 3.1 CHAR和VARCHAR;...个值 (3)ENUM和SET值是以字符串形式出现,但在内部MySQL以数值形式进行存储; ENUM: (1)在基本数据类型中,无外乎就是写数字和字符串,但是某些事物是较难用数字和字符来准确表示...(4)如果插入SET字段中值有重复,则MySQL自动删除重复值,插入SET字段顺序并不重要,MySQL会在存入数据库时,按照定义顺序显示 更新表数据语法; UPDATE

82720

OpenTSDB简介

如果我们每秒存储一个数据点,每天就有86400个数据点,在hbase里就意味着86400行数据,不仅浪费存储空间,而且还查起来慢,所以OpenTSDB做了数据压缩上优化,多行一一行多,一行多一行一...数据开始写入时其实OpenTSDB还是一行一个数据点,如果用户开启了数据压缩选项,OpenTSDB会在一个小时数据写完或者查询某个小时数据时对其做多行一行数据压缩,压缩后那些独立点数据就会被删除以节省存储空间...多行一一行多 ? 我们原始数据可能长这样,一个小时总共有3600行数据。...里面的value是UTF-8编码json串。 一行多一行一   在2.2版本,opentsdb进一步对数据存储做了优化,把每个Row里3600合并成了一,存储格式如下。...Tree   2.0版本提出了tree概念,tree必须与metadata合用。大概就是metadata里信息按照各种规则将其转换为树形结构方便用户查看,类似计算机里数据文件目录。

2.2K10

印尼医疗龙头企业Halodoc数据平台转型之Lakehouse架构

源数据以不同格式(CSV、JSON)摄取,需要将其转换为格式(例如parquet),以将它们存储在 Data Lake 中以进行高效数据处理。...我们利用 DMS 从 MySQL DB 读取二进制日志并将原始数据存储在 S3 中。我们已经自动化了在 Flask 服务器和 boto3 实现帮助下创建 DMS 资源。...CSV 或 JSON 数据等不可变数据集也被转换为格式(parquet)并存储在该区域中。该层还维护或纠正分区以有效地查询数据集。 5....• 由于某些后端问题,未更新已修改数据质量问题。 • 架构更改很难在目标中处理。...提取每个事件更改新文件是一项昂贵操作,因为会有很多 S3 Put 操作。为了平衡成本,我们 DMS 二进制日志设置为每 60 读取和拉取一次。每 1 分钟,通过 DMS 插入新文件。

1.8K20

字符串和时间转换sql「建议收藏」

oracle: 当前时间:sysdate – dual (Oracle中一张内部表,只有一行一,一般用作特定查询) 时间字符串: to_char(date,format) select to_char...('2018-02-23 15:33:21','yyyy-mm-dd hh24:mi:ss') 字符串时间 from dual; 2018-02-23 15:33:21 两个参数格式必须匹配 mysql...12) %d:代表月份中天数,格式为(00……31) %e:代表月份中天数, 格式为(0……31) %H:代表小时,格式为(00……23) %k:代表 小时,格式为(0……23) %h:...代表小时,格式为(01……12) %I: 代表小时,格式为(01……12) %l :代表小时,格式为(1……12) %i: 代表分钟, 格式为(00……59) %r:代表 时间,格式为12 小时...(hh:mm:ss [AP]M) %T:代表 时间,格式为24 小时(hh:mm:ss) %S:代表 ,格式为(00……59) %s:代表 ,格式为(00……59) sqlserver: 当前时间

1.3K20

玩转Mysql系列 - 第10篇:常用几十个函数详解

lower 字符串中字母转换为小写 upper 字符串中字母转换为大写 left 从左侧字截取符串,返回字符串左边若干个字符 right 从右侧字截取符串,返回字符串右边若干个字符 trim...) %i 分钟, 数字(00~59) %r 时间,12 小时(hh:mm:ss [AP]M) %T 时间,24 小时(hh:mm:ss) %S (00~59) %s (00~59) %p AM或PM...TIME_TO_SEC(time) 函数返回参数 time 转换为秒数时间值,转换公式为“小时 ×3600+ 分钟 ×60+ ”。...SEC_TO_TIME(seconds) 函数返回参数 seconds 转换为小时、分钟和秒数时间值。...聚合函数 函数名称 作用 max 查询指定最大值 min 查询指定最小值 count 统计查询结果行数 sum 求和,返回指定总和 avg 求平均值,返回指定数据平均值 MySQL

3K20

为什么Vitess推荐每个MySQL服务器250GB?

这是实际MySQL限制吗? 简而言之:不一定。所谓“实际限制”,我意思是当MySQL达到250GB数据库大小时,它会立即崩溃吗?在物理极限之前达到实际极限是很常见。...因为惟一索引上插入模式是随机,所以不能保证所需索引页在内存中。但是必须加载这些页以确保没有违反约束检查(c必须是惟一)。...我们还可以通过RANDOM_BYTES(512)转换为插入效率更高但仍然是512字节内容来提高性能: SELECT LENGTH(CONCAT(current_timestamp(6), RANDOM_BYTES...有效插入可以扩展到多远? 当缓冲池从16GB降低到128MB时,表A只损失了13%插入性能。为了证明没有明确“最大行数”限制,现在让我们测试运行时间延长到5小时。...它甚至鼓励你在同一主机上运行多个MySQL实例(多个tablet)。 总结 通过指定推荐大小,Vitess作者还可以对某些操作需要多长时间进行假设,并简化系统设计。

1K30
领券